# Restockr release config — vending-machine restock planner.
# Release manager notes: route optimizer now reads machine inventory
# from the Cobblenook telemetry feed every 15 minutes.
# Planner cutoffs: 04:00 local per depot; do not change without ops signoff.
# Staging uses the same feed at reduced polling.
# The planner authenticates to the telemetry feed, and the next line sets that credential.

secret setting of yafof-tawep: RELAY_SECRET8=8abb5772

Onboarding: Crashfall Pipeline (security review). Crashfall ingests crash dumps from the Lintbird mobile app, strips device identifiers, and forwards symbolicated reports to the Quillstone triage queue. Ingest workers run in an isolated subnet; egress is allowlisted to the symbol store only. Workers authenticate to the symbol store with a signing token loaded from the env file. Add the following line to .env.crashfall:

vault entry, baweg-hahog: COURIER_KEY5=337d5

## Deployment

The Quillbarrow service ships as a slimmed container image. We build in two stages: a full toolchain stage compiles the binary, then we copy only the binary and CA certificates into a distroless base. Final images should stay under 25 MB; the CI gate fails anything larger. Don't add shell utilities for debugging — use the ephemeral debug sidecar instead. Strip symbols with the release build flags already wired into the Makefile. The image builder and registry behavior are controlled by the configuration below.

deployment values, fahap-hahaf:
[casdor]
port = 9200
region = south-2
host = casdor.qirvanworks.corp
timeout_ms = 3000
retries = 4